The journey from Palasa to Surajpur is a long-distance trip covering over 900 kilometers. You will travel through the scenic landscapes of Odisha and the northern parts of Chhattisgarh. The most practical way is to take a train to Ambikapur or Bilaspur and then hire a taxi to Surajpur. Driving is an option but requires multiple days due to the distance and terrain. Expect a travel time of 18 to 20 hours by train.

Total Distance: 900 km by road, 650 km air distance.

Things to Do in Surajpur
1
Kudargarh Temple
Visit this famous temple located on a hilltop. It is a major pilgrimage site in the region.
2
Tamor Pingla Wildlife Sanctuary
Explore the rich biodiversity of this sanctuary. It is a paradise for nature lovers.
3
Mahamaya Temple
Experience the spiritual atmosphere at this ancient temple. It is highly revered by locals.
4
Local Markets
Explore the local markets for traditional tribal crafts and forest produce.
